Half of the Queens cycle is behind us. I'd like to remind about a few deadlines 
and how they affect us:

1. Jan 18th is the non-client library release deadline. It affects ironic-lib 
and sushy. The latter has a few outstanding changes - please try to find some 
time to get them a bit of attention. We have one months left, minus holidays.

2. Jan 25th is the client release deadline. If you work on new API, it has to 
land before that point with its client change to end up in ironicclient Queens.

3. Jan 25th is also the feature freeze. We haven't had a formal feature freeze 
for a few cycles. But after troubles with releasing Pike we decided to get back 
to it.

Feature freeze exceptions *may* be given to priority work, low-impact vendor 
changes and low-impact work substantially improving operator's and/or user's 
experience. Feature freeze exceptions are unlikely to be granted to major API 
additions or breaking changes.

If you think your work may be affected by the feature freeze, please start 
planning accordingly.
